For the past two weeks, Italy, a “precursor” country in the spread of the virus in Europe, has been living to the rhythm of this question: so, this time, are we there? Everyone is anxiously awaiting the peak of the epidemic, the point at which the number of infected people must begin to drop under the effect of the confinement imposed on the whole nation on March 11, and which must allow us to envisage sooner or later the end of the restrictions. However, everything indicates that the Italians will have to take their troubles patiently.
Because twenty days after the national confinement, the Deputy Minister of Health, Pierpaolo Sileri, recognized that "Italy will not be at its peak before 7 to 10 days" . So the government plans to extend the confinement from April 3 at least until 18. Nevertheless, finally clearly states the director of the Institute of Health, Silvio Brusaferro, "even if the number of cases does not decrease still, the slowdown of the virus is indeed there.
